The excruciating trait of this lasting wait for Godot comes into existence from the uncertainty feeling. They encounter Lucky and Pozzo, they discuss their miseries and their lots in life, they consider hanging themselves, and yet they wait.

However, his judgment to wait for Godot is a preference in itself. The play consists of conversations between Vladimir and Estragon, who are waiting for the arrival of the mysterious Godot, who continually sends word that he will appear but who never does.
